Bus station hiking trails in Puszcza Bieniszewska explore a youthful glacial landscape, characterized by moraine hills, glacial gutters, and diverse forest ecosystems. The region features varied terrain, including distinct ramparts and rising hills, with slopes up to 30 degrees. This area is part of the Powidz-Bieniszewo protected landscape, offering a mix of oak-hornbeam, mixed, and riparian forests. Small lakes are interspersed among the forest hills, adding to the natural features.

What kind of terrain can I expect on bus-accessible hikes in Puszcza Bieniszewska?

The terrain in Puszcza Bieniszewska is shaped by a youthful glacial landscape, featuring varied relief. You'll encounter terminal moraine hills, glacial gutters with steep edges, and ground moraine surfaces. Some areas, like Złota Góra, offer more significant elevation changes, making for engaging hikes.

What natural features can I see along the bus station hiking trails?

The trails often lead through diverse forest ecosystems, including rich oak-hornbeam, mixed, and riparian forests. You can also discover striking glacial features like moraine hills and deep glacial gutters, and some routes pass by small, scenic lakes nestled among the hills.
